  • Title

    Signal Processing for Semiconductor Detectors

  • Abstract
    This is a tutorial paper designed to provide a balanced perspective on the processing of signals produced by semiconductor detectors. The general problems of pulse shaping to optimize resolution with constraints imposed by noise, counting rate and rise time fluctuations are discussed.
